Log home sta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to the exterior of a log or timber home. This process typically includes cleaning the surface to remove dirt, mold, or old finishes, followed by applying stain or sealant to enhance the wood’s appearance and durability. The goal is to provide a uniform, attractive look while helping to preserve the logs against weathering, UV rays, and moisture intrusion. Many service providers also offer advice on the best staining products suited for specific types of wood and climate conditions.

One of the primary benefits of log home staining is its ability to address common issues such as fading, cracking, and wood deterioration. Over time, exposure to sun, rain, and temperature fluctuations can cause logs to lose their natural color and become more susceptible to damage. Regular staining helps maintain the home’s aesthetic appeal and extends the lifespan of the logs by creating a barrier against environmental stressors. It also offers an opportunity to refresh the appearance of a home that may have become dull or weathered over the years.

Discover typical Log Home Staining project ranges for Boulder, CO.

Per Square Foot - Log home staining services typically range from $2 to $4 per square foot. Larger homes or complex designs may increase the cost, with some projects reaching $5 or more per square foot.

Per Hour - Some contractors charge between $50 and $100 per hour for staining work. The total cost depends on the project's size and the labor required to complete it.

Flat Rate - Flat pricing for staining a log home generally falls between $1,500 and $4,000. This estimate varies based on the home's size, condition, and the type of stain used.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$200 to $500 or more. These costs depend on the home's condition and the scope of prep work needed.

How often should log homes be stained? The recommended staining frequency for log homes typically ranges from every 3 to 5 years, depending on climate and exposure. Contact local service providers to determine a suitable schedule for specific conditions.

What types of stains are available for log homes? There are various stain options including trans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ains, each offering different levels of protection and appearance. Local pros can help select the best type for a log home's needs.

Can staining improve the appearance of a log home? Yes, staining can enhance the natural beauty of logs, add color, and provide a uniform look. Consulting with local specialists can help achieve desired aesthetic results.

Is it necessary to prepare a log home before staining? Proper pre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is often recommended to ensure optimal stain adhesion. Local contractors can advise on the best preparation methods.
